    The current approach Model 204 (M204) is the underlying mainframe technology for the Department of Human Services (DHS) core Income Security Integrated System (ISIS), which is a system that Centrelink has used to help with social welfare payments for last 30 years. Since M204 was introduced in 1983, there have been bolted over 350 additional components on top of the M204 database.
